Forte supports persons who are developmentally disabled or otherwise physically challenged through family driven initiatives to manage their own affairs in their own homes. Forte Residential, Inc is a certified Medicaid Waiver Provider in the state of Indiana. We provide services to recipients of the Community Integration and Habilitation (CIH) Waiver, Family Support Waiver (FSW), and Aged & Disab

led (A&D) Waiver. Forte Residential, Inc provides Residential Habilitation Services (RH1O, RH2O), Community Habilitation (CHIO), Respite Services, Attendant Care and Homemaker Services as allowed by each respective waiver. Forte Residential is currently approved to provide waiver services in 31 northern Indiana counties. Forte Home Health Care provides Medicaid PA (home health aide and skilled nursing) services for individuals requiring assistance in their homes. Forte Home Health Care provides services in 21 counties in Indiana. We work with each individual and their unique situation to pursue a barrier-free, fulfilling, safe, productive, and enjoyable life.

Millions of people with disabilities rely on Medicaid home and community-based services (HCBS) to live in their homes and be part of their communities. These services help pay for direct support professionals, daily care, and the support people need to live healthy lives in their own communities.

But after the biggest Medicaid cuts in history last year, many states are now struggling to make up for lost funding, which could mean longer waiting lists and less access to these critical services. And now, Congress is considering more cuts!

A message from The ARC:

Voting is a basic right. But for many people with disabilities, voting is not easy. Inaccessible polling places, transportation barriers, and strict ID requirements are all real obstacles that keep eligible voters from voting.

And right now, things are getting worse.
• Congress is debating the SAVE America Act, a bill that would add new barriers to voter registration and make mail-in voting harder.
• On March 31, the President signed an executive order that could block the U.S. Postal Service from sending absentee ballots to millions of eligible voters.

For people with disabilities, that's a big deal. More than half of voters with disabilities cast their ballot by mail in 2020, and that right needs to be protected.
